It is crucial that you always change your air filters when needed. It will keep the air in your home healthier, and it’s good for your air conditioning system. Most of the time, a unit stops functioning properly because the filter is dirty.

Put a stop to your squeaky floor by using construction adhesive. You have to work in your crawlspace or in the basement, but it is going to be worth it. With a caulker, put some glue on all the floor joists, so that glue secures subfloor planks to each joist.

Replacing a door’s hinge may be the best idea if it squeaks. Fortunately, these are easily located at most home improvement stores. Removing the old hinge and installing the new one is an easy project. You then align the hinges so you can replace pins.

A drill is a necessary part of many renovations. This will help you make holes and place screws in them without any special attachments. Choose a battery powered, cordless drill with a variety of attachments and drill bits capable of handling both Phillips and flat-head screws.

Be sure to protect your flooring when you paint. Taking this precaution will save you from wet paint staining carpets or floors. A cheap way to get this done is using old newspapers in your layers. You may also use plastic sheeting or a paint cloth to protect your floor from dripping paint.

Insulation is something worth investing in. Use weather-stripping on all windows and doors. When you minimize the air flow in and out of your home, you can run your environmental and temperature controls with far better efficiency. This means that you will save money on your energy bills.

The addition of a bathroom to the home can increase the value of your home. A second bathroom can be really helpful, especially when you have more than one floor in your house. It is not uncommon for multiple people to need a bathroom at the same time.

Always know where the gas shutoff valve is when you start any gas-based DIY project. You should also be extremely cautious when working in close proximity to a gas line. Starting a fire or causing an injury during your project is undesirable.

Surprisingly, home lose as much as one fifth of the energy through their windows. Adding a second glaze to your larger windows can easily reduce this amount by half, making your electric bills much more reasonable and also making your home more comfortable during extreme temperatures.

If your home is in a drier region, consider fencing made of white or red cedar. Cedar wood is solid, will last long and will not burn easily in case a fire starts on your property.

Straight bristles makes for easier sweeping. You can damage the broom by standing it upright. Rather than setting the broom on the floor, buy a hook from which to hang it. That way, the bristles stay straight, and the life of the broom is significantly extended. Also, mops should be stored in the same fashion, thereby preventing mildew.
